Popular places to visit in Kenya
Nairobi
Nairobi is a popular destination for Melbourne to Kenya flights. Sheldrick Wildlife Trust Nursery, Giraffe manor and Mara Conservancy are must-sees for first-time visitors.
Nairobi's main airports are Nairobi Jomo Kenyatta Airport (NBO) and Nairobi Wilson Airport (WIL). You'll find some competitive flight deals between the two.

Mombasa
The biggest draws in Mombasa include Mombasa Marine Park & Reserve, Fort Jesus Museum and Mombasa Beach.
The majority of flights arrive through Mombasa Airport (MBA), the city's main airport.

Visiting Kenya for the first time? Here's what you need to know
Know the entry rules well before departure day. Rules can change depending on your reason for travel and your passport. Always check with official sources like your airline, the local embassy or your travel agent.
The Kenyan shilling (KES) is the local currency.
Kenya has a population of roughly 58 million. The capital city is Nairobi.
This destination operates on one standard time zone of UTC+3.
The weather can shape everything from what you wear to what you see, so choose your season wisely. March is Kenya's warmest month.
Temperatures are often coolest around January.
You can expect more rain in November, while January is usually drier.
The most popular events on the local calendar include Jamhuri Day independence celebrations, Lamu Cultural Festival and The Kenya Music Festival. Time your Melbourne to Kenya flight around moments like these for an experience that goes beyond sightseeing.
